Watersports Instructors

Wildfinder is an outdoor adventure company, running tours and gear hire that gets people into mountain biking, kayaking and stand up paddle boarding, bush walks and even white water rafting. We’re after some awesome watersports instructors, to become part of the Wildfinder team on a casual part time basis:

Lead Instructor:

You’ll be the glue that holds our school watersports programmes together - operating out of our site in Days Bay, you’ll be leading school groups (with support from assistant instructors); teaching kids the basics of kayaking and paddleboarding, and organising water games to put these skills into practise. You’ll be in charge of time management of the sessions, in line with school schedules. You’ll love working with kids and helping them learn whilst having an awesome time.

Assistant Instructor:

Operating out of our site in days Bay, you’ll be assisting the Lead Instructor with our school watersports programmes. Helping fit life jackets, teaching kids the basics of kayaking, and assisting out on the water in organised games. You’ll love helping the kids and watching them learn new skills, whilst they have a great time out on the water.

For both roles:

There will also be the opportunity for casual customer service work at our Days Bay site during the summer months: helping get guests out onto the water, water safety, booking in guests, and making real fruit icecreams!

Essential attributes - the successful applicants will be

Kayaking Qualifications / Experience (the Lead Instructor must have qualifications to teach kayaking in NZ. The Assistant Instructors must have kayaking experience)

Great with kids

Outgoing and confident

Fit, healthy, and happy to get stuck in to physical work

Passionate about the outdoors

Responsible and reliable

Bonus skills - not essential but may help you stand out

First aid certs

Experience working with children
